Boost Your Efficiency: Choosing the Right Fins
Unlock your full potential in the water with the optimal pair of fins. Picking the right fins can dramatically affect your performance by enhancing your propulsion. Fins come in a variety of designs, each suited to specific swimming goals.
Consider your experience level when making your decision. Beginners may benefit from shorter, flexible fins for better stability, while proficient swimmers may prefer longer, stiffer fins for increased power.
